Automatic tempfile offline due to write error on

Hi everybody,
I am getting the following in my alert log and my TEMPFILE went offline.
KCF: write/open error block=0x5a909 online=1
file=4 /database1/oratemp1/temp1_04.dbf
error=27091 txt: 'HP-UX Error: 28: No space left on device
Automatic tempfile offline due to write error on
file 4: /database1/oratemp1/temp1_04.dbf
The funny thing is I found that it is not autoextensible. The sapce in the mount point is 100% utilized. But why would such an error come when the tempfile is in autoextend off??
Any ideas?
Thanks in advance

Hi.
Oracle does not guarantee whether temp datafiles are fully allocated on file system by OS when you create a temp tablespace or a add tempfile.
Usually it will not be fully allocated on file system until you fully utilize the temp space.
You should make some free space for tempspace to (really) allocate in the volume
or create another temp tablespace on another volume and switch to it.

    hello,
    let me recap first:
    you see these errors on a ROOT CA. so it seems like the ROOT CA is also operating as an ISSUING CA. Some clients try to issue a new certificate from the ROOT CA and this fails with your error mentioned.
    do you say that you had a PREVIOUS CA which you decomissioned, and you now have a brand NEW CA, that was built as a clean install? When you decommissioned the PREVIOUS CA, that was your design decision to don't bother with the current certificates that it
    issued and which are still valid, right?
    The error says, that the REQUEST signature cannot be validated. REQUESTs are signed either by itself (self-signed) or if they are renewal requests, they would be signed with the previous certificate which the client tries to renew. The self-signed REQUESTs
    do not contain CRL paths at all.
    So this implies to me as these requests that are failing are renewal requests. Renewal requests would contain CRL paths of the previous certificates that are nearing their expiration.
    As there are many such REQUEST and failures, it probably means that the clients use AUTOENROLLMENT, which tries to renew their current, but shortly expiring, certificates during (by default) their last 6 weeks of lifetime.
    As you decommissioned your PREVIOUS CA, it does not issue CRL anymore and the current certificates cannot be checked for validity.
    Thus, if the renewal tries to renew them by using the NEW CA, your NEW CA cannot validate CRL of the PREVIOUS CA and will not issue new certificates.
    But it would not issue new certificates anyway even if it was able to verify the PREVIOUS CA's CRL, as it seems your NEW CA is completely brand new, without being restored from the PREVIOUS CA's database. Right?
    So simply don't bother :-) As long as it was your design to decommission the PREVIOUS CA without bothering with its already issued certificates.
    The current certificates which autoenrollment tries to renew cannot be checked for validity. They will also slowly expire over the next 6 weeks or so. After that, autoenrollment will ask your NEW CA to issue a brand new certificate without trying to renew.
    Just a clean self-signed REQUEST.
    That will succeed.
    You can also verify this by trying to issue a certificate on an affected machine manually from Certificates MMC.
    ondrej.

    Hi Saif,  Are you using the same xsd for the outbound (write) file adapter as well? In that case, you may need to map both the names (Fname and Lname) but leave the name which you do not want to be written to the file as an empty text. For example, if you would need to map only the Lname, but not the Fname, the xsl will be like,
    <xsl:template match="/">
        <imp1:Root-Element>
          <xsl:for-each select="/imp1:Root-Element/imp1:Employee">
            <imp1:Employee>
              <imp1:Fname>
              <xsl:text disable-output-escaping="no"></xsl:text>
              </imp1:Fname>
              <imp1:Lname>
                <xsl:value-of select="imp1:Lname"/>
              </imp1:Lname>
            </imp1:Employee>
          </xsl:for-each>
        </imp1:Root-Element>
      </xsl:template>
    </xsl:stylesheet>
    Another option is to have a separate xsd with only one element (Fname or Lname) for the outbound file adapter, in which case you would need to map only one field.

    When attempting a reinstall of iTunes, I cant delete the file C\Program Files\Common Files\Apple\Internet Services\Shellstream.resources due to same error message as described above for iPod file; however i can't find it anywhere in the Task Manager

    That one's consistent with disk/file damage. The first thing I'd try with that is running a disk check (chkdsk) over your C drive.
    XP instructions in the following document: How to perform disk error checking in Windows XP
    Vista instructions in the following document: Check your hard disk for errors
    Windows 7 instructions in the following document: How to use CHKDSK (Check Disk)
    Select both Automatically fix file system errors and Scan for and attempt recovery of bad sectors, or use chkdsk /r (depending on which way you decide to go about doing this). You'll almost certainly have to schedule the chkdsk to run on startup. The scan should take quite a while ... if it quits after a few minutes or seconds, something's interfering with the scan.
    Does the chkdsk find/repair any damage? If so, can you get an install to go through properly afterwards?
